The Trump administration has been charged with claims of siphoning almost $4m from a program that is serving to New York firefighters and medics suffering from 9\/11 related casualties.<\/p>\n
Reports state the treasury department halted payments to the program around four years ago and even today the cause remains unknown.<\/p>\n
National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health<\/a> performed the task of sanctioning all the payments to the plan but during these events, the treasury started keeping money with itself.<\/p>\n According to the program\u2019s director and FDNY\u2019s chief medical officer, Dr. David Prezant that nor a legal statement has been issued neither authorities have been apprised as to why all the payments have stopped to the program.<\/p>\n Half a million dollars went missing during the years 2016-2017 and later these figures went up to six lakh and thirty million in the year 2018. While in august 2020 a hefty amount of $1.44 million went missing.<\/p>\n Authorities are already facing crucial times financially due to COVID 19 and since there is no aid coming for the program unfortunately sick workers and firefighters are not being medically treated the way they should be.<\/p>\n\n
